Program Notes

This piece is meant to represent unity through division. Written for the combined percussion ensembles of Boyd County High School (KY) and Marshall University (WV), the piece explores both melodic and rhythmic ideas that are distinctly different, yet clarity and unison is present when combined. In geographic terms, the name is also meant to represent the division of Ashland and Huntington by state border, yet cohesion and unity with the culture of the region.
